Indian President's XI v West Indies A - 3 day First Class match 1991/2 - Lucknow

Toss: West Indies A

West Indies A won the toss and elected to give their 5 man seam attack of a Green first morning pitch in Humid conditions which would aid swing.
The Indian President's XI openers gave them a good start, but 4 wickets to fast medium bowler Henderson Bryan saw them slip to 189/6 and in some trouble.
Allrounder Manoj Prabhakar and keeper C.S.Pandit came to the rescue with fighting half centuries, adding 97 for the 7th wicket and putting the home side in a strong position.
The President's XI elected to bat on in the hope of securing a big enough total to make the follow on a threat.
Though the West Indies A seamers enjoyed the seaming conditions, it was an inconsistent display by the bowlers and they let a good situation slip, allowing the lower order to double the score.
